Spectra and tilings play an important role in analysis and geometry respectively, the relationship between them has led to a lot of conjecture, for example Fuglede spectral set conjecture, Reeds and Wang established a characterization of spectra and tilings that can be used to prove a conjecture of Jorgensen and Pedersen by Keller’s criterion. Different techniques to prove these facts have also been respectively developed by Iosevich, Pedersen and Kolountzakis later. For a common goal, the preliminary studies are trying to figure out the relationship between spectra and tilings. On the basis of former achievements, this paper continues to study spectra and tilings and presents an simple method of describing certain characterizations of spectra and tilings. The results here extend several known conclusions in a simple manner. Finally, this paper also shows certain characterizations of period sets.
